Currency (Ae2) 392-395 AD
Roman Empire
Metal: Bronze.
Issuing entity: Rome. Theodosius I.
Mint: Nicomedia (Izmit, Turkey).
Date: 392-395 AD
Obverse:
Pearl-diademed and draped bust right. Legend: D N THEODO - SIVS P F AVG.
Reverse:
Emperor standing facing with head right holding standard and globe. Legend: GLORIA - ROMANORVM. Mint mark: SMNB.
Weight: 4.93 g - Diameter: 21 mm - Axes: 1 h.
Described in: RIC IX 46 a var.
Published in:
Ramón Sánchez, J.J., García Barrachina, A., Verdú Parra, E., Bayo Fuentes, S., 2010: "Catálogo. Antigüedad", in Ramón Sánchez, J.J. (ed.), Monedas. Todas las caras de la Historia. Colecciones numismáticas del MARQ, Alicante, p. 125.
Monetary Inventory Number: 1251.
